<p><strong>ADVICE TO FATHERS!</strong></p>
<p>As the father of the bride you have an opportunity of a lifetime!  As your daughter becomes engrossed in the details of planning this extravaganza you have the opportunity to make an indelible mark on your daughter&#8217;s psyche.  This is a chance for you to put down the television remote, walk away from your computer and give your daughter the most amazing gift&#8211;you!  Many fathers perceive that a check and a walk down the aisle is all that is required during this transition period.  Even though that is an option don&#8217;t set the bar so low for yourself!</p>
<p>Tip # 1 for Fathers of Brides</p>
<p>From now until your daughters wedding spend 30 minutes every week doing something special for your daughter!  Send a random note telling her a few of the things that make her so special to you&#8230; Emails will do but a handwritten note and 44 cents for postage will be more than worth the expense.</p>
<p>Tip # 2 for Fathers of Brides</p>
<p>Get ready to waltz?  Well for most fathers they are probably not the first choice for &#8220;Dancing with the Stars&#8221;!  Even if you daughter doesn&#8217;t plan on doing a difficult dance it might be time to start learning something out of your comfort zone.</p>

<p><strong>Things To Keep In Mind</strong><br />
The duo above took a slightly unusual approach to their traditional dance.  Even though every bride is going to have different reasons for picking a song you might want to consider</p>
<p>1. What tempo does the song have?<br />
2. Have you talked to your daughter, or daughters have you talked to your father, about this event and received their input?<br />
3. Don&#8217;t get to stressed out over this choice&#8230;There are a lot of other stresses probably vying for your attention.</p>
<p>Alternative Option of the Day!</p>
<p>Some brides have found that as much as they want to show their love, respect and admiration for their dad they also want to move away from the normal approach to this event.  One alternative method is to combine both parent dances into one simultaneous dance!  This allows the bride and groom to carry out the traditional dances honoring their parents without the headaches of having to choose two songs.</p>
